    Carpal tunnel release is a specialized surgical procedure performed to relieve pressure on the median nerve in the wrist. Carpal Tunnel Syndrome occurs when this nerve becomes compressed due to swelling or narrowing of the carpal tunnel, leading to pain, numbness, tingling, and weakness in the hand and fingers.

    Are You Experiencing Numbness or Weakness in Your Hand?

    Tingling in the fingers, numbness in the thumb and first two fingers, hand weakness, or pain that worsens at night are common signs of carpal tunnel syndrome. Over time, untreated nerve compression can lead to reduced grip strength and difficulty performing routine tasks.

    When to Consider Carpal Tunnel Release Surgery

    You may be advised to undergo carpal tunnel release if you:

    • Experience persistent numbness or tingling in fingers

    • Have hand or wrist pain affecting daily activities

    • Wake up at night due to hand discomfort

    • Notice weakness or dropping objects frequently

    • Do not improve with splints, medications, or physiotherapy

    • Have nerve damage confirmed on diagnostic tests

    Understanding Carpal Tunnel Release Surgery

    Carpal tunnel release is a minimally invasive procedure aimed at reducing pressure on the median nerve. During the surgery, the surgeon carefully cuts the transverse carpal ligament, creating more space within the tunnel and relieving nerve compression.

    The procedure can be performed using open or endoscopic techniques, both of which are safe and effective. It is usually done under local anesthesia and takes a short time, allowing patients to return home the same day.
